Ride into the tumult of the Battle of Flodden Field with a narrative poem that reads with the urgency and excitement of an action novel. The tale follows a flawed hero, a nobleman whose quest for a wealthy marriage leads him into a web of forgery, betrayal, and eventually, the thick of combat. It captures the rugged beauty of the Scottish borders and the tragic grandeur of a doomed military campaign. The work is celebrated for its galloping rhythm and vivid imagery, cementing the author's reputation as a poet before his ascent as a novelist.
